Motorcycle Rider Killed, Body Dumped in Maize Farm in Jos South

By Azi Peter – Jos

A young man was brutally murdered and his motorcycle stolen in Kanganchik Village, Zawan District, Jos South Local Government Area.

The victim, a resident of Manguna District in Bokkos Local Government Area, was killed by armed robbers who have been terrorizing the community.

The community is gripped by fear and sadness, with residents mourning the loss of their loved one.

The Ward Head, Da Paul Dalyop Christopher, expressed frustration and agony over the rising insecurity in the area.

“This is not the first time we’ve lost lives to these criminals,” he said. “Just two months ago, a lady’s corpse was found in the area.”

The Ward Head appealed to the government to convert the land into a market square, suggesting that the Kugiya Market could be relocated there.

He also urged the government to make a law banning the farming of tall crops, such as maize, which the criminals use as a hiding place. “We can’t continue to live in fear,” he said. “We need protection, or we’ll be forced to stage a protest.”

The Youth Leader, Sunday James, corroborated the Ward Head’s statement, expressing disappointment over the loss of innocent lives.

“This is the fourth time we’ve picked up bodies of our loved ones,” he said. “We can’t just sit back and do nothing. We need the government to secure our community.”

The community came together to mourn the loss of the young man, with women, youths, and motorcycle riders gathering in large numbers to pay their respects.

The Nigerian Police Force, B Division Bukuru, evacuated the dead body.
